NHFPL Foundation
The New Haven Free Public Library Foundation raises funds to support the mission of the New Haven Free Public Library and builds awareness of the Library's community impact.

In 2017, the New Haven Free Public Library Foundation launched the Stetson Library: The Next Chapter campaign to move the Stetson Branch Library into a new home in the Q House. As a cornerstone of the reimagined community center, the new Stetson Library will enjoy a 60% increase in space and will feature an expanded collection of books and materials, improved and enhanced services, state-of-the-art technology and hands-on learning equipment to better serve the evolving needs of New Haven’s residents.
